What MiniMax H3 Is Designed to Do

H3 treats text, images, video and audio as a connected brief. A prompt can identify the product image, motion clip and audio reference, then generate picture and native stereo sound together.

The official specification supports up to nine images, three reference videos and three audio clips, subject to a 12-file mixed-input maximum. It also supports text-to-video, first- or last-frame control, paired keyframes and reference-to-video workflows. These are provider specifications, not independent quality findings.

H3 Base produces 768p. The official 2K workflow regenerates that result with the original context, adding another production and billing step.

How We Tested MiniMax H3

This article links to Loova AI’s hosted H3 route. The review did not submit fresh generations or receive MiniMax review credits; it audited public MiniMax and Loova AI samples. Source references were compared with output frames, six frames were sampled across a 15-second brand video, and downloaded media metadata was checked.

That method can assess visible reference use, temporal stability and delivered media format. It cannot establish first-pass success rate, moderation behavior, queue time or the average number of retries.

Test Setup and Evaluation Criteria

For a reproducible trial, open the current MiniMax H3 model page and use one fixed asset pack for three runs. Score reference fidelity, product stability, motion, audio and editing usability. Save the prompt, settings, date and credit preview.

Only upload product files, faces, voices and footage you are authorized to use. Consent and source licensing matter more when a reference is intended to survive into the output.

MiniMax H3 Quality Tests

Product-Reference Video Test

The published brand sample uses four source images to establish binocular-shaped eyewear, a cream-black-red palette and “MINIMAX” signage. Across six sampled points in its 15-second output, those elements recur through the planned locations. That supports reference-pack interpretation.

It does not prove that H3 will preserve a real package on demand. The inputs resemble storyboard frames, and one showcase reveals nothing about rejected takes. Test an asymmetrical product, small label and fixed color swatch across three runs; reject changes to silhouette, label placement or color.

Motion-Transfer Test

MiniMax’s published examples show reference video being used to guide action or camera behavior. However, when a sample also contains several character and style references, the contribution of motion transfer cannot be isolated.

Use one licensed four-to-six-second source clip, one character and a static background. Score pose timing, limb path, framing, identity and background stability. Side-by-side playback or an overlay exposes timing drift.

Dialogue and Stereo-Audio Test

The public sample files inspected for this review contained two-channel AAC audio. That confirms those demos were delivered with stereo tracks; it does not prove meaningful left-right staging, clean dialogue or reliable lip sync.

A useful test places two speakers on opposite sides of a locked frame, each with different dialogue and a directional sound cue. Review transcript, speaker assignment, mouth timing, channel placement and ambience separately.

MiniMax H3 Strengths and Weaknesses

Strengths

  • Mixed references can describe subject, setting, motion and sound inside one brief.
  • The 4–15-second duration range is more flexible than a single fixed clip length.
  • Native stereo audio creates a plausible starting point for dialogue and ambience.
  • Released Base checkpoints give technical teams a local 768p route.

Weaknesses

  • Public showcase quality does not reveal average retry count.
  • Dense reference packs make a failure harder to diagnose.
  • Accurate small text, package geometry and multi-shot continuity still require project-specific tests.
  • Local Base deployment does not include the hosted Context-IR or full 2K regeneration modules.

Production Cost and Retry Considerations

As of August 13, 2026, MiniMax’s direct-API list price is $0.08 per output second at 768p and $0.13 at 2K. The first five reference images are free, additional images cost $0.04 each, and reference video is billed by its duration at the selected resolution rate. These figures come from the official pay-as-you-go pricing page and can change.

A 15-second 2K output therefore starts at $1.95. Three attempts cost $5.85 before chargeable references. Add a six-second 2K reference video and each attempt reaches $2.73, or $8.19 for three. The more useful planning formula is:

Accepted-shot cost = total generation and reference charges ÷ approved shots

Loova AI uses its own credit system, so do not transfer MiniMax API dollar rates to that route. Record the displayed credit preview, failed-run treatment and actual retry count before approving a batch budget.

Who Should Use MiniMax H3?

H3 is a strong pilot candidate for product concepts, stylized brand videos, motion-led scenes or dialogue clips. It also suits developers who can support local deployment.

Wait if every label must be exact, throughput must be predictable or confidential references cannot enter a hosted service. Those jobs need a private test set and verified data route.

Final Verdict

The strongest part of this MiniMax H3 performance review is the workflow design: one context can connect references, motion and stereo audio, while durations up to 15 seconds leave room for a complete beat rather than a micro-shot.

The limitation is evidence. The published MiniMax H3 video examples show that the model can produce coherent, ambitious results, but they do not disclose how many attempts were required. MiniMax H3 is worth a three-run pilot with your own hardest asset—not a production-wide commitment based on demos alone.

FAQ

Is MiniMax H3 the Same as Hailuo 3.0 or Hailuo AI?

No. MiniMax H3 is the model name. Hailuo AI is MiniMax’s creator-facing video platform, and the official H3 repository lists it as an online app route. “Hailuo 3.0” is not the model name used in the current H3 documentation. Use the exact model label when comparing prices, settings or results.

Can MiniMax H3 Run Locally, or Is It Only Available Through Platforms Like Loova AI?

It can run locally, but with an important limit. MiniMax has released H3 Base checkpoints for first/last-frame and reference-to-video generation, with support paths for SGLang, vLLM, Diffusers and ComfyUI. Its example SGLang deployment uses four GPUs. The hosted Context-IR and 2K regeneration modules are not included, so local 768p Base output is not identical to the full hosted workflow.
